Description by the author

The name Sevenoaks comes from the Anglo-Saxon word Seouenaca, this was a small chapel near seven oak trees in what is today Knole Park. Discover Knole Park and the surrounding forests with this walk. The route starts at the train station of Sevenoaks and takes you along the Knole country house through the woods to Godden Green. The majority of the route goes through wooded landscape, making it ideal for enjoying the silence and tranquility!
